The Maggie graph shows what looks like a KR cough at 4200RPM... so that kind of skews the KB ahead after that... until the KB takes over and seperates around 5000 RPM. While the KB continues to pull real hard this shows how close the teansy weansy MP112 runs with a big twin screw. I bet the numbers would have been a little closer had the comparison shown a KB 2.6L on an LS1 versus LS6... all other inputs remaining the same regarding this comparison. Super nice numbers for both. BTW... I have seen that little 4-4.2k KR blip too many times to count on GENIII motors... NA or FI...

The Z06 has better heads, different headers/exhaust, more compression, and alky injection.
The 01 has a camshaft and 2 more pounds of boost.
Too many variables there to get a good comparison IMHO. The KB did post higher numbers than I've seen outta a 112 maggie on a LS car though so that can't be disputed at all.
